Universal Robots unveils its AI Accelerator , enabling a new wave of AI-powered cobot innovations
Universal Robots , the Danish collaborative robot ( cobot ) company , has presented for the first time the UR AI Accelerator – a ready-to-use hardware and software toolkit created to further enable the development of AI-powered cobot applications .
Designed for commercial and research applications , the UR AI Accelerator provides developers with an extensible platform to build applications , accelerate research and reduce time to market of AI products .
The toolkit brings AI acceleration to Universal Robots ’ ( UR ) nextgeneration software platform PolyScope X and is powered by
NVIDIA Isaac™ accelerated libraries and AI models , running on the NVIDIA Jetson AGX Orin™ systemon-module . Specifically , NVIDIA Isaac Manipulator gives developers the ability to bring accelerated performance and state-of-the-art AI technologies to their robotics solutions . The toolkit also includes the high-quality , newly developed Orbbec Gemini 335Lg 3D camera .
With everything seamlessly integrated , the toolkit offers developers full go-to-market architecture and is ready to use straight out of the box .
Through in-built demo programs , the AI Accelerator leverages UR ’ s platform to enable features like pose estimation , tracking , object detection , path planning , image classification , quality inspection , state detection and more . Enabled by PolyScope X , the UR AI Accelerator also gives developers the freedom to choose exactly what toolsets , programming languages and libraries they want to use and the flexibility to create their own programs .
